BRADFORD Bulls have announced the permanent signing of Luke Hooley on a two-year deal.

The 27-year-old came through the junior ranks at the Bulls, before going on to play for Wakefield, Batley, Leeds and Castleford.

He rejoined Bradford on loan from the latter back in March, making his debut in the Challenge Cup tie against Salford.

The full-back has since played a pivotal role in the club’s charge to the Betfred Championship play-off semi-finals, scoring eight tries and kicking 63 conversions.

Hooley said: “I am over the moon to finally get it done and secure my future for the next couple of years.

“I’ve said in multiple interviews that it felt like home from day one and I was welcomed with open arms.

“I wanted to carry that on and go on the path Bradford are going on, so hopefully now I can kick on and finish the year strongly.

“I started my career here in the Under-19s and it’s where I signed my first professional contract, so I have been on a big circle.

“But now I have ended up back at the club and it is good to secure a deal here and look forward to the next couple of years.”

Hooley added: “The club is pushing for Super League, there’s no hiding that.

“You’d like to think Bradford are up there and I have a lot to prove in Super League, so hopefully third time lucky and I can secure a spot week in, week out to show everyone what I can do.

“On a personal level since I’ve returned to the club, I think I’ve done okay.

“I set myself a few personal goals back in March, what I wanted to do and where I wanted to get to, winning the 1895 Cup was on there but it doesn’t always work out.

“I think I’ve gone alright and hopefully this weekend I can help us get to the Grand Final.

“I just wanted to come back and fall in love with game again, as you can do a pre-season knowing know you won’t get a proper chance, but I thought I had a good dig this year.

“It ultimately didn’t work out at Castleford, but hopefully I can have a good pre-season, starting fresh at a new club.

“The fans have been part of it all, as they have done nothing but sing my praises and I have loved every minute.

“They are a good, large group and we will need them again this weekend.”

Bulls head coach Brian Noble said: “Luke has shown why clubs like Leeds and Castleford both showed an interest in him and signed him to be a Super League player.

“I think he understands, and we do too, that there is lots of improvement in him.

“Even though he does some things wonderfully well, a good pre-season here will make him even better.

“We have got another excellent full-back in Tom Holmes and Luke has managed to keep him out of that position.

“Tom is now thriving in the halves, so it was a necessary signing in March that has worked out for us.”
